Tizen is an open source, standards-based software platform supported by leading mobile operators, device manufacturers, and silicon suppliers. Tizen enables development platform and OS for the connected future. Tizen platform supports smartphones, In-vehicle infotainment (IVI), smart TV, notebooks, tablets, and more. In this session, we will outline the vision and goals of the project, and give pointers to the technical details, architecture, and building blocks needed to develop Tizen OS based solutions. All the development is happening at tizen.org and we will provide a preview of features under development.
Schedule
Mon 11
9:00 – 9:20am
9:20 – 9:35am
9:35 – 9:50am
9:50 – 10:05am
10:05 – 10:30am
10:30 – 10:45am
10:45 – 11:35am
11:35am – 1:00pm
[13:00] 1:00 – 1:40pm
Tizen is addressing the need for quality by using a leading edge appscore to identify the best apps to make Tizen a success. Using an advanced machine learning algorithm, apps created on cross platform tools like Marmalade are identified early and then given the resources (technical and financial) to port the app to Tizen. It is the first time a true meritocracy has been developed for an app ecosystem.
Trevor Cornwell is the founder and CEO of appbackr inc., a market exchange for apps. Based on its appscore, appbackr ranks apps based on quality and delivers incentives to developers that apps that new platforms want on their platform.
In this session, Havok's industry experts will walk through the features available in Project Anarchy that empower developers to make exciting, graphically rich games for mobile platforms. They will discuss some of the common challenges in mobile game development and how the Havok toolset helps solve them using features like the asset management system, LUA scripting, remote input system, file serving, and so much more. Creating games can be hard, but they will show you how Project Anarchy makes it easy and even fun!
[13:45] 1:45 – 2:25pm
HERE, a Nokia business. Why HERE on Tizen?
- Map platform features scope
- Rendering
- Search
- Routing
- Geocoding
- Traffic
- Positioning
- Regional coverage
- Demo
- Competitiveness of HERE Maps
- Outlook
2013 HERE, a Nokia business / Director, OEM programs and SDK
Sencha Architect enables developers to build robust applications quickly and easily with new features such as templates, user extensions, code completion and theming. Sencha Sr. Solutions Engineer, Stefan Stšlzle, will demonstrate the all-new Sencha Architect 3 and show you how to build powerful Tizen HTML5 applications.
Over the past year Tizen IVI project evolved to include a set of automotive specific user experience management components. In this talk I will walk through the current architecture for controlling the user experience and also detail how this work will continue to evolve over the next year.
[14:30] 2:30 – 5:05pm
14:30 - 15:30:
- Tizen Resources
- Tizen SDK Overview – “Web Views”
- Tizen Design Principles
15:30 - 16:20:
- Native API Development
16:20 - 17:10:
- Tizen Store/Validation/IAP,Deeplink
[14:30] 2:30 – 3:10pm
At the days of "HTML5 Era", an advanced and rich multimedia communicating functions are essentially required for any smart terminals. The close coordination with many kind of sensors, numerous data basis, touch screens with appropriate design and animations are strongly desired with 3D operations. Therefore, 3D applications developments are complicated and enormous complex and taking huge time & cost by using conventional programming, even it is JavaScript.
MatrixEngine is the software development system, with designer-friendly complete high-end authoring tool, for HTML5 Rich Internet Apps. It allows 3D projects in significantly less time and expense with creator's creativity.
Native application executables can be treated as data by utilizing VIVID Runtime. By encrypting data with our ARG, even if the data is extracted, it will not execute on an unauthorized terminal. For this reason, native applications can be distributed in an encrypted format with our DRM processing. Acrodea intends to monetize this business at the electronic delivery platform for DRM-protected native applications.
[15:40] 3:40 – 4:20pm
Enable your Android apps on Tizen platform with OpenMobile Application Compatibility Layerª (ACLª). With our ACL technology, your Android apps can run seamlessly alongside native Tizen and web apps on any Tizen platform. Getting started is easy, as ACL allows unmodified Android apps to execute on the millions of Tizen devices expected to ship in 2013. Don't miss out, enable your Android apps for Tizen ecosystem now! Tizen is growing and now is the time to embrace the open nature of the platform. You want to be a part of this ecosystem, leverage your investment in Android apps to get them running on a new wave of mobile devices.
This discussion will be presented by Yasin Hamed, OpenMobile's VP EMEA Strategy. Yasin will explain how ACL works and what is required to take advantage of this opportunity to enable your Android apps on Tizen platform. Be sure to attend!
Crosswalk is an open source Web Runtime developed by Intel.
It aims to provide a portable enabler for HTML5+CSS+JavaScript based applications, but extending what is provided by the web platform. It comprises of an application Runtime Model, an implementation of the W3C SysApps APIs, and a JavaScript Extension Framework which allows vendors to add native capabilities. It uses Blink as its rendering and layout engine and Chromium's Content Module.
In this presentation, Leandro Pereira will be introducing Crosswalk and its Extension Framework by covering its architecture and key benefits. They will also demonstrate a set of Tizen Web APIs implemented with Crosswalk and benchmarks, which outperformed the current Tizen Web Runtime since day 1.
For last, they aim to provide feedback about the design of Tizen APIs and how they can be improved for Tizen 3.
[16:25] 4:25 – 5:05pm
This presentation provides the introduction to publish the existing android apps to Tizen appstore using the automated conversion/repackaging technology and the Android player called as PAG(POLARIS App Generator). The app developers just do as they did with Android SDK, and they just export their Android app to Tizen using this automated conversion tool or service, PAG(POLARIS App Generator.
In beginning stage of new platform, there are not enough devices for making profit. So, it's not easy to invest to make a new version of applications for new platform. With this conversion tool, the app developer can publish their app at low cost, because they can use almost of the Android apps they already developed. In the point of view of the developers, they can make one source, and they use (publish) it for multiple platforms.
Tizen platform comes with an interesting and dynamic security solution. The platform images available on Tizen.org include security policies specifically crafted for the Open Source Tizen platform. But what are you to do if you want to utilize Tizen and want to modify the security policies that come as part of the platform? This tutorial will walk through all of the platform security configuration and show how you can change the configuration to meet your security policy and needs.
[17:10] 5:10 – 5:50pm
Marmalade Technologies CEO Harvey Elliott and key members of their engineering team demonstrate the ease at which developers can target Tizen platform using the cross-platform Marmalade SDK. The powerful and versatile Marmalade SDK allows developers to target multiple operating platforms, including Tizen, using a single codebase, saving time and money for the developer. Marmalade is used by top game studios worldwide and has enabled the development of major hits including Draw Something, Plants vs. Zombies and Tap Paradise Cove as well as mobile versions of the Call of Duty, Need for Speed and Pro Evolution Soccer series
We would like to discuss Tizen platform and how it is easy to participate in and developer-friendly, by comparing Tizen with the current situation of other OS platforms.
[18:00] 6:00 – 8:00pm
[20:00] 8:00 – 11:00pm
Session Track Key
- Application Development / 应用程序开发
- Platform Development / 平台发展
- Other